Output 28d17baa3ce46c6b76e549c3262e4e6f2c2c1da40522c385cf39e2de339e204a:1

value
9343203262000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bdb34903d543e3df41e08dd1b4242acfb6abfbf1 OP_EQUALVERIFY OP_CHECKSIG
address
PqDpdHw81MEgvzrR1RxwGLUTxFjUxMvwyT
transaction
28d17baa3ce46c6b76e549c3262e4e6f2c2c1da40522c385cf39e2de339e204a